    Ah! I was wondering if there was a thread for Legacy B/W Tokens. I have been running a deck like this for the last couple of months. I haven't played it in any real Legacy tourneys yet but it has been doing very well for me in casual Legacy games so far. It is certainly no joke.

    The goal of mine is to play or tutor out Bitterblossom on the first couple of turns like Stoneforge goes after Jitte, while protecting it with discard. Then playing tokens and fetching whatever the matchup calls for. The sideboard is similarly heavy on silver bullets. Sure, a Tranquility would suck, but in this meta it is pretty rare, so this is a rogue's feast of tokens.

    At the beginning, I was playing spectral procession too as 5th to 8th copies of lingering souls but this spell is pushing the manabase too far (3 whites) for a version running Liliana of the veil.
    I tried a new version playing some other plan than swarming the board :

    A flyers package :

    Bitterblossom and Lingering souls are just the best token generators. I play only 3 bitter because i play some other 2 cc bombs.

    Pw plan : disruption and Win condition

    Liliana is a versatile card and deck running black have to play it. It is strong against combo and aggro-control decks, and pretty effective against heavy control deck. Lingering soul + liliana is an easy path to the victory.
    Sorin is fit for this deck, all abilities are useful at a time : he can stall the board (giving us life and a body each turn), push our aggro forward (his emblem can't be removed from the game, virtue can be shut down) and his ultimate is pretty insane (he is a good counter to Jace decks)

    Stoneforge plan : Stalling and Win condition

    The best white plan works so fine with Flyers with the classical package (Jitte / Batterskull / SOFI). Jitte with the new legend rules will be very hard to remove from the board.

    Some creatures : Win condition

    The major problem of this deck is that it lacks solutions against engineering explosives (0) and early pernicious dead so one solution is to offer some other threat in other CC range.
    Deathrite shaman is the best 1 drop atm. He can be a mana dork, a life gain and a pressure. He can also be a preboard hate grave a nice counter to t1 lackey.
    Mirran crusader is just insane against BUG decks and become deadly with some equipment. This beater is unconditional.

    Some Utility slot :

    8 fetchs and 3 sensei divining top offer a draw filter engine.
    2 Vindicate because this card is a paragon of versatility even if its 3 CC is sometime too slow. With the 4 Wasteland it can become a mana denial plan.

    The sideboard is very combo oriented because we don't have T0 solution as blue decks. I play silence over other discard effects because he can be used even if your opponent have Leyline in play.
    The O-ring are against S&T decks.
    Some reinforcement against grave decks (can be used against RUG) and some solution against elves (zealous + perish) and gob (zealous). Perish can give us a solution against NO + progy.

    This deck is very fun to play because it got a lot of winning condition. I'm wondering about playing a 61 MD cards for the third Liliana.
